
888AFRICA adds VP of performance marketing to growing senior team
Ex-GOAT Interactive head Sorin Nichita links up with Christopher Coyne-led venture in latest appointment


888AFRICA has bolstered its growing senior team with the appointment of Sorin Nichita as VP of performance marketing and BI.
Nichita joins the JV from GOAT Interactive – the company behind West Africa-facing online operator PremierBet – where he served as head of insights from May 2021 until May 2022.
He is reunited with 888AFRICA CEO Christopher Coyne in his new role, with Coyne having previously served as GOAT Interactive CEO.
Prior to joining GOAT Interactive, Nichita spent more than two years as head of online marketing for Editec, a gambling consultancy firm specialising in the African market.
The JV has enacted a recruitment drive since its establishment, which saw a host of industry stalwarts join CEO Coyne.
Former William Hill chief product officer Alex Rutherford and ex-Premier Bet CFO Helen Scott-Allen are involved with the venture, as well as Ian Marmion who will head up trading.
Voxbet chair and former MD of The Stars Group’s sportsbook, Andrew Lee, is also part of the JV.
Former Betsson VIP lead Ryan Newton has been named as VP of VIP, while ex-The Stars Group manager Steven McIntosh was onboarded as VP of product.
The JV will pay a brand licence fee to 888 to utilise its product portfolio in “selected” regulated markets in Africa. The plan is to initially launch in four countries before growing its footprint to 10 in the long term.
